59/*
60 * Code to handle exceptions in C.
61 */
62
63struct jmploc *handler;
64volatile sig_atomic_t exception;
65volatile sig_atomic_t suppressint;
66volatile sig_atomic_t intpending;
67char *commandname;
68
69
70static void exverror(int, const char *, va_list) __printf0like(2, 0);
71
72/*
73 * Called to raise an exception.  Since C doesn't include exceptions, we
74 * just do a longjmp to the exception handler.  The type of exception is
75 * stored in the global variable "exception".
76 */
77
78void
79exraise(int e)
80{
81	if (handler == NULL)
82		abort();
83	exception = e;
84	longjmp(handler->loc, 1);
85}

88/*
89 * Called from trap.c when a SIGINT is received.  (If the user specifies
90 * that SIGINT is to be trapped or ignored using the trap builtin, then
91 * this routine is not called.)  Suppressint is nonzero when interrupts
92 * are held using the INTOFF macro.  If SIGINTs are not suppressed and
93 * the shell is not a root shell, then we want to be terminated if we
94 * get here, as if we were terminated directly by a SIGINT.  Arrange for
95 * this here.
96 */
97
98void
99onint(void)
100{
101	sigset_t sigset;
102
103	/*
104	 * The !in_dotrap here is safe.  The only way we can arrive here
105	 * with in_dotrap set is that a trap handler set SIGINT to SIG_DFL
106	 * and killed itself.
107	 */
108
109	if (suppressint && !in_dotrap) {
110		intpending++;
111		return;
112	}
113	intpending = 0;
114	sigemptyset(&sigset);
115	sigprocmask(SIG_SETMASK, &sigset, NULL);
116
117	/*
118	 * This doesn't seem to be needed, since main() emits a newline.
119	 */
120#if 0
121	if (tcgetpgrp(0) == getpid())
122		write(STDERR_FILENO, "\n", 1);
123#endif
124	if (rootshell && iflag)
125		exraise(EXINT);
126	else {
127		signal(SIGINT, SIG_DFL);
128		kill(getpid(), SIGINT);
129	}
130}

133/*
134 * Exverror is called to raise the error exception.  If the first argument
135 * is not NULL then error prints an error message using printf style
136 * formatting.  It then raises the error exception.
137 */
138static void
139exverror(int cond, const char *msg, va_list ap)
140{
141	CLEAR_PENDING_INT;
142	INTOFF;
143
144#ifdef DEBUG
145	if (msg)
146		TRACE(("exverror(%d, \"%s\") pid=%d\n", cond, msg, getpid()));
147	else
148		TRACE(("exverror(%d, NULL) pid=%d\n", cond, getpid()));
149#endif
150	if (msg) {
151		if (commandname)
152			outfmt(&errout, "%s: ", commandname);
153		doformat(&errout, msg, ap);
154		out2c('\n');
155	}
156	flushall();
157	exraise(cond);
158}
159
160
161void
162error(const char *msg, ...)
163{
164	va_list ap;
165	va_start(ap, msg);
166	exverror(EXERROR, msg, ap);
167	va_end(ap);
168}
169
170
171void
172exerror(int cond, const char *msg, ...)
173{
174	va_list ap;
175	va_start(ap, msg);
176	exverror(cond, msg, ap);
177	va_end(ap);
178}
